Technical Data

Specifications & Materials

Technical specifications for custom rubber-to-metal bonded parts used in automotive vibration damping, mounting, and support applications.

Product Specifications
Product Type Rubber-to-Metal Bonded Parts
Parent Category Custom Rubber Parts
Category Rubber-to-Metal Bonded Parts
Compound Material Meets ASTM D2000
Compliance Options FDA, NSF, RoHS, REACH
Material Brands ZEON, LANXESS, Dow Corning, DuPont
Hardness 10–90 Shore A
Insert Material Metal insert, as per request
Surface Quality Smooth surface with small parting line
Quality System IATF 16949 Certified
Inspection Standard AQL 1.0 / 0.65 / 0.15, C=0 Zero Defect
Tooling In-house tooling, 2 CNC machines operating 24H per day

Available Compounds

  • NR Rubber

    Natural rubber provides excellent elasticity and resilience, making it suitable for rubber-to-metal bonded parts used in vibration damping and cushioning applications.

    High Elasticity Vibration Damping Cushioning Use
  • SBR Rubber

    SBR is a cost-effective rubber material with good abrasion resistance, suitable for general rubber-to-metal bonded parts and mounting components.

    Cost-Effective Abrasion Resistant General Use
  • NBR Rubber

    NBR provides good oil and wear resistance, making it suitable for automotive bonded parts used near machinery, oil, or grease-contact areas.

    Oil Resistant Wear Resistant Automotive Use
  • EPDM Rubber

    EPDM offers strong resistance to weather, ozone, aging, and moisture, making it suitable for automotive parts exposed to outdoor or humid environments.

    Weather Resistant Ozone Resistant Outdoor Use
  • HNBR Rubber

    HNBR provides improved heat, oil, and wear resistance compared with standard nitrile rubber, making it suitable for demanding automotive bonded components.

    Heat Resistant Oil Resistant Durable
  • Neoprene Rubber

    Neoprene offers balanced resistance to abrasion, weathering, and mild chemicals, suitable for general automotive and industrial bonded rubber parts.

    Abrasion Resistant Weather Resistant General Purpose
